Our first time visiting this Dominican restaurant in Jamesburg. It will not be our last. The food was absolutely delicious. Very similar to Puerto Rican food which we love. The dishes were cooked perfectly and were filled with such amazing flavor. Can't wait to eat the leftovers later today. The restaurant is quite unique. They have an area that serves pre-prepared food for takeout with a large sitting area if you decide to eat there. They also have a full-on menu if you plan on dining there with lots of great choices. The atmosphere and the dining area is nothing special. But you're not going there for the aviance. You're going there for incredible food. They do have a separate room that looks like for special events. Very fancy. Fine dining looking. Not sure the purpose of that room but it looked very nice. The staff was friendly. It helps if you know Spanish as, I'm not sure she spoke English. The food came out very quickly and again I can't say how much we enjoyed it. I will certainly be back again and again and again.
